Bethesda continues to apologise for lack of Skyrim DLC on PS3

October 5, 2012 by Julie Horup

At least it’s not Sony’s fault.

Hearthfire DLC launched for Skyrim on PC yesterday, and the expansion has already been available on Xbox 360 for a while, but how about the PS3 players? Well, you're still not getting anything.

The only thing you're getting from Bethesda is an excuse and another explanation as to why Sony's platform acts up every time Bethesda wants to release DLC for their games.

Yesterday Pete Hines took to Twitter (via Eurogamer) to let PS3 gamers know that Bethesda is still working on a solution, but so far it's not looking too good.

"We're still on it," he said. "Will share update when I have one."
 
"The performance isn't good enough in all cases," Hines added. "For most folks, it'd be fine. For some, it wouldn't be."

The comments led to an angry fan lashing out, telling Hines that Bethesda should own up to their own faults, which they actually do.

"We've never blamed anyone or anything. It's our problem, and it's on us to solve it."
